Understanding the Structure of a Conservatory
A conservatory usually consists of different aspects that interact to create a practical and visual area. The primary components of a conservatory consist of:
Frame: Made from products such as uPVC, aluminum, or wood, the frame supports the roof and walls.Glazing: Glass panels, which can be single, double, or triple-glazed, offer insulation and natural light.Roof: This might be a glass roof or a solid structure, with alternatives for vented glass or panels.Base and Dwarf Walls: The foundation offers stability and may include brick or block work.
Understanding these parts is necessary for recognizing potential issues and understanding the appropriate method for reparations.
Typical Frame Issues
Conservatory frames are vulnerable to a variety of problems, a lot of commonly due to age or direct exposure to the elements. Here are some of the common issues that may develop:
Deterioration of Material:
Wooden frames can rot due to wetness.uPVC frames might end up being brittle gradually and can break under extreme conditions.
Misalignment:
Frame parts may warp or settle, causing misalignment.This can create gaps that allow heat loss or water ingress.
Weather condition Damage:
Intense sun exposure can trigger fading or structural weakening.Heavy storms can lead to water pooling and frame damage, specifically in locations where rain gutters are clogged.
Structural Instability:
